Download guide
Meccha Chameleon Download: Official Steam and Safe Install Guide
Find the official Meccha Chameleon Steam page, understand the browser embed, and avoid unsafe download mirrors or fake installers.

Use the official Steam page
For the full Meccha Chameleon game, Steam is the right path for purchase, install, updates, cloud features, community posts, and refund handling. This site links out instead of hosting installers.
- Open Steam from the link on this page or search the app ID 4704690.
- Confirm Windows support and current system requirements before buying.
- Use Steam client updates instead of third-party patch files.
What the browser player is for
The homepage iframe is an instant browser hide-and-seek game. It helps visitors try a similar loop without installing anything, but it is not the official Meccha Chameleon build.
Do not mix the two
Use the browser embed for quick play. Use Steam for Meccha Chameleon itself.
Safe install checklist
A multiplayer game depends on current builds and trusted account systems. Fake installers are especially risky because they can ask for Steam credentials or ship outdated files.
- Do not enter Steam credentials into a third-party download page.
- Avoid archives that claim to bypass Steam.
- Verify game files in Steam if installation behaves strangely.
- Read recent Steam community posts when a new patch changes connection behavior.
Frequently asked questions
Where do I download Meccha Chameleon?
Use the official Steam store page. This site does not host Meccha Chameleon installers.
Is a free download mirror safe?
Treat it as unsafe unless it is an official Steam or developer-controlled path. Random mirrors can be outdated, modified, or credential-stealing.